" Rural Health Unit 2 Animal Bite and Treatment Center, proudly serving the community of Santa Catalina with unwavering dedication, now re-certified by the DOH. "

"We are pleased to announce the successful re-certification of our Animal Bite and Treatment Center (ABTC) by the Integr...
17/07/2025

"We are pleased to announce the successful re-certification of our Animal Bite and Treatment Center (ABTC) by the Integrated Provincial Health Office (IPHO), Department of Health (DOH) Region VII and DOH Negros Island Region (NIR), having met all 57 out of 57 criteria. This accomplishment is a testament to our continued commitment to excellence in public health service and the provision of quality health care. We extend our gratitude to the DOH and IPHO evaluators and to our dedicated team for their hard work and unwavering dedication."

Barangay Mabuhay conducted "Palarong Babies" program promotes physical activity among children, helping to prevent overweight and obesity. This initiative is complemented by health education sessions for mothers, focusing on the "Pinggang Pinoy" food guide and the "10 Kumainments" to encourage healthy eating habits. The comprehensive approach of combining physical activity and nutritional education demonstrates a proactive commitment to the long-term health and well-being of the community's youngest members. This holistic strategy is crucial in addressing childhood obesity and establishing healthy lifestyle patterns from an early age.

Barangay Amio is among the fortunate recipients of a vital nutrition program, receiving maternal milk supplements (a three-month supply) for pregnant women and five kilograms of rice for mothers with undernourished children. This initiative extends beyond mere provision of food; it includes crucial educational components. Beneficiaries received valuable learnings about Pinggang Pinoy and the Ten Kumainments, empowering them with the knowledge to make informed food choices and ensure optimal nutrition for themselves and their families.
